DB2 UDB for LUW Administration des Objets

4 jours | 4-UDB02

Logo PDF

Formations Informatiques > Base de données > Les Bases de données DB2-UDB for Z/OS

Prochaines sessions inter-entreprises

  • Du 18/06/2012 au 21/06/2012
  • Du 18/09/2012 au 21/09/2012
  • Du 20/11/2012 au 23/11/2012

Objectifs

Ce stage vous permettra de maîtriser l'administration DB2-UDB sous Windows. Vous étudierez les objets.de la base, l'intégrité référentielle, ainsi que la navigation dans les tables du catalogue. Par analogie,vous verrez aussi comment administrer DB2-UDB en environnement Linux/Unix.

Participants / Pré-requis

Connaissances de base des SGBDR, du langage SQL et de DB2-UDB. Ou connaissances équivalentes à celles apportées par le stage "DB2-UDB, prise en main" (réf. DBA). Expérience souhaitable avec DB2-UDB.

Contenu

Rappels sur l’environnement UNIX/ linux et NT face à Z/OS

Les Objets Fondamentaux (Partie I)

  • Hiérarchie des objets
  • Database
  • généralités
  • ordre de création
  • catalogage d’une base
  • répertoire systeme et de base de données
  • activation d’une base
  • connexion
  • Tablespace
  • type de tablespace (sms & dms)
  • notion de container et d’extent
  • tablespace sms
  • tablespace dms
  • ordre de creation
  • liste des tablespaces
  • Schéma
  • généralités
  • ordre de création
  • TP : création d’une base de données, tablespace & schéma

Les Objets Fondamentaux (Partie II)

  • Hiérarchie des objets
  • Règles des noms d’objets DB2 UDB
  • Table
  • généralités
  • type de données ordre de création
  • copie de table
  • les « summary table » : création et utilisation
  • liste de table
  • Vue
  • généralités
  • création & utilisation
  • Index
  • généralités
  • création & utilisation
  • Alias
  • généralités
  • création & utilisation
  • Nickname
  • généralités
  • création & utilisation
  • COMMENT ON
  • Limites
  • TP : création des tables, vues, index et alias

Modification des objets

  • Modification
  • commentaire de base de données
  • tablespace
  • table
  • vue
  • nickname
  • Suppression
  • base de données
  • tablespace
  • table
  • vue
  • nickname
  • TP : modification d’un tablespace, d’une table

Intégrité Référentielle

  • Généralités
  • Terminologie
  • Clé Primaire
  • définition
  • utilisation
  • Clé Etrangère
  • définition
  • utilisation
  • Règles De Mise à Jour
  • définition
  • restrict
  • cascade
  • set null
  • exemple
  • Suppression
  • Table « Delete-Connectee »
  • L’instruction Set Integrity
  • definition
  • Utilisation
  • Restrictions
  • TP : ajout de contraintes référentielles, création des contraintes CHECK

Gestion des Autorisations

  • généralités
  • la gestion des utilisateurs UDB
  • systèmes d’exploitation et UDB
  • Les autorités au niveau de l’instance et de la base de données
  • SYSADM
  • SYSCTRL
  • SYSMAINT
  • DBADM
  • les privilèges de base de données
  • schéma
  • table ou vue
  • index
  • gestion de la sécurité UDB
  • les utilisateurs
  • les groupes
  • le groupe public
  • accorder des droits : l’instruction GRANT
  • au niveau de la base de données
  • au niveau d’un schéma
  • au niveau des tables ou des vues
  • au niveau des index
  • retirer des droits : l’instruction REVOKE
  • au niveau de la base de données
  • au niveau d’un schéma
  • au niveau des tables ou des vues
  • au niveau des index
  • TP : gestion des autorisations de la base de données

Le Catalogue

  • Généralités
  • Les vues du catalogue
  • les vues du schéma SYSCAT
  • les vues du schéma SYSSTAT
  • Description détaillée des vues relatives à la gestion
  • de la base de données
  • des tablespaces
  • des tables
  • des vues
  • des index
  • TP : visualisation des création et modification des objets à l’aide des vues du catalogue.

Architecture et Structure Interne Des Objets

  • Architecture UDB
  • généralité
  • processus
  • mémoire
  • stockage
  • Architecture d’une base de données
  • généralités
  • répertoire
  • fichiers
  • Gestion de l'espace
  • structure d’une page
  • insertion de ligne
  • mise à jour
  • ajout de données
  • Index
  • PCTFREE
  • MINPCTUSED
  • Table
  • PCTFREE
 
Aix Ajaccio Albi Amiens Angers Annecy Bastia Bayonne Belfort Blois Bordeaux Bourges Brest Caen Chambery Chartres Chateauroux Châlons-en-Champagne Clermont-Ferrand Colmar Dax Dijon Épinal Grenoble ile de la Réunion La Défense La Rochelle Le Mans Lille Limoges Lyon Marseille Metz Montpellier Mulhouse Nancy Nantes Nice Niort Orléans Paris Pau Périgueux Poitiers Reims Rennes Rouen Saint-Brieuc Saint-Dié-des-Vosges Saint-Etienne Strasbourg Toulouse Tours Valence Vannes Vincennes